Berg is a senior partner at private equity firm 26North Commissioner will succeed Don Garber The Major League Soccer board of governors has voted to install LAFC co-managing owner Larry Berg as the league’s next commissioner, according to a source familiar with the vote. Sportico was first to report the news. Berg will succeed Don Garber as the head of the 30-year-old league, with a term starting after Garber officially steps down. He will be the third commissioner in MLS history. Continue reading...

Owners led by Gabriel Brener paid £15m in 2023 Buyer would be the club’s fifth owner in six years Charlton’s US owners have put the club up for sale just three years after taking over at the Valley. The Championship’s ownership group is understood to have engaged Oakwell Sports Advisory to find what would be the club’s fifth owners in the past six years. In a sales deck sent to potential investors, which has been seen by the Guardian, Oakwell describes Charlton as “the last remaining football club upside opportunity in London”.
